Corinna Vinschen <corinna-cygwin <at> cygwin.com> writes:
> That means the patch to sshd isn't that important.  Nevertheless, I
> just released cygrunsrv-1.60-1, which prepends /bin to $PATH.
> 
> Funny enough, the README file claimed that /bin gets prepended to $PATH
> since the early days.  Just the actual code didn't follow suit :-P

The help output from the command still talks about adding it to PATH, so
that may actually have been intentional: prepending /bin might mess up
things if someone actually wants to get something in front.  All things
considered, I suggest that cygrunsrv doesn't fiddle with the PATH if an
explicit PATH environment has been given on the command line, but prepends
it to the PATH if it gets inherited from Windows.
